Paradies Lagardere Default is Hiring a Bourbon Pub Kitchen Supervisor - Paradies Lagardere, San Francisco International Airport Near San Francisco, CA

Duties and Responsibilities 

  • Be first to market in new products, innovation, and points of difference.
  • Conduct regular Quality Assurance tastings and evaluations to ensure recipe adherence, food quality, and consistency.
  • Launch/expand successful prepared food product lines and implement successful exit strategies for unproductive merchandise.
  • Completes all required reports, logs, and culinary audits/reviews in a timely manner.
  • Lead, contribute to and execute parts of the culinary strategic plan for the division.
  • Launch line reviews in support of customer and seasonal expectations.
  • Leverage fact-based decision making to drive growth and profitability.
  • Assists in kitchen schematics design and recommends adjacencies that support the efficiency of the space.
  • Orientates new cooks within their respective area, core culinary standards and established food programs.
  • Provides support for new restaurant openings and/or renovations.
  • Provides leadership to culinary team members.
  • Assists with training, coaching and development of culinary team members.
